Are you in the market for a nice Japanese import title?  Do you love the majestic artwork that Studio Ghibli presents?  Well, then you’re in luck!  Launching this week is the Studio Ghibli inspired title, Ni no Kuni: The Jet Black Sorcerer.

Ni no Kuni: The Jet Black Sorcerer follows the tale of Oliver, who discovers a fairy that leads him into an alternate reality where magic and mystery might allow him to revive his recently deceased mother.
